What is California BanCorp's estimated fair value?
California BanCorp (BCAL) reported estimated fair value of $298.62M in Q1 2026.
How has California BanCorp's estimated fair value changed year-over-year?
California BanCorp's estimated fair value increased by 126.9% year-over-year, from $131.59M to $298.62M.
What is the long-term trend for California BanCorp's estimated fair value?
Over 3 years (2022 to 2025), California BanCorp's estimated fair value has grown at a 27.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$112.58M to $234.89M.
